|
Accrued Collaboration Credit (Details) - USD ($)
|3 Months Ended
|6 Months Ended
|12 Months Ended
|
Jun. 30, 2025
|
Mar. 31, 2025
|
Dec. 31, 2024
|
Sep. 30, 2024
|
Jun. 30, 2024
|
Mar. 31, 2024
|
Jun. 30, 2025
|
Jun. 30, 2024
|
Dec. 31, 2024
|Accrued Collaboration Credit [Roll Forward]
|Beginning Balance
|$ (981,111)
|$ (981,111)
|Ending Balance
|$ (219,625)
|$ (981,111)
|(219,625)
|$ (981,111)
|TOI Collaboration Agreement
|Accrued Collaboration Credit [Roll Forward]
|Beginning Balance
|(738,534)
|(981,111)
|$ (201,536)
|$ 0
|$ 0
|(981,111)
|$ 0
|0
|Prepaid expenses included in reimbursement, not yet incurred
|163,277
|251,304
|92,546
|(788,934)
|(450,056)
|0
|414,581
|(450,056)
|(1,146,444)
|Accrued expenses for work performed, not yet invoiced
|351,681
|(9,420)
|45,814
|$ (126,340)
|248,520
|0
|342,261
|248,520
|167,994
|Foreign currency adjustments
|3,951
|0
|4,644
|0
|Ending Balance
|$ (219,625)
|$ (738,534)
|$ (981,111)
|$ (201,536)
|$ 0
|$ (219,625)
|$ (201,536)
|$ (981,111)
|X
- Definition
+ References
Accrued Collaboration Credit, Current
+ Details
No definition available.
|X
- Definition
+ References
Accrued Collaboration Credit
+ Details
No definition available.
|X
- Definition
+ References
Collaborative Arrangement, Accrued Expense Adjustments
+ Details
No definition available.
|X
- Definition
+ References
Collaborative Arrangement, Deferred Collaboration Credit Adjustments
+ Details
No definition available.
|X
- Definition
+ References
Collaborative Arrangement, Foreign Currency Adjustments
+ Details
No definition available.
|X
- Details